SUMMARY:Ape-ril® Discovery Days at the BioPark Zoo
DESCRIPTION:Join us every Saturday in April for special Discovery Days! Visit our tabletop Discovery Stations to learn about the great apes that live at the ABQ BioPark and the challenges facing their wild counterparts. You can also pick up some Great Ape-ril® merch\, 100% of the proceeds go to great ape conservation! \nSee how our primate zoo babies are growing up\, like Bulan the orangutan\, gorillas Gila and Mashika\, and Rahsia the siamang! The 2026 highlights are: \n\nApril 4: Chimpanzees on the Ape Walk\n\nHuman-Animal conflict focus: illegal pet trade\n\n\nApril 11: Siamangs in Asia\n\nHuman-Animal conflict focus: habitat fragmentation\n\n\nApril 18: Orangutans in Asia\n\nHuman-Animal conflict focus: palm oil farming\n\n\nApril 25: Gorillas on the Ape Walk\n\nHuman-Animal conflict focus: coltan mining\n\n\n\nThese Great Ape-ril® events are included with regular admission.

SUMMARY:Kodomo no Hi (Japanese Children's Day)
DESCRIPTION:Join us for Japan’s national holiday honoring children. \n\nKodomo no Hi\, or Children’s Day\, is celebrated in Japan on May 5th. On this national holiday\, children are respected and honored for their individual strengths and happiness is wished upon them. Families celebrate Kodomo no Hi by flying colorful koi kites called koinobori which represent the members of the family\, kids wear kabuto origami helmets\, and families display samurai dolls. \nTogether with our community parters\, we will celebrate with activities and demonstrations at various locations in the Botanic Garden! \nFull schedule details coming soon! \n\nFree with regular admission.
